256704341 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 256704342. Its totient is φ = 256704340.

The previous prime is 256704323. The next prime is 256704359. The reversal of 256704341 is 143407652.

It is a balanced prime because it is at equal distance from previous prime (256704323) and next prime (256704359).

It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 220403716 + 36300625 = 14846^2 + 6025^2 .

It is a cyclic number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 256704341 - 26 = 256704277 is a prime.

It is equal to p14025686 and since 256704341 and 14025686 have the same sum of digits, it is a Honaker prime.

It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 256704298 and 256704307.

It is a congruent number.

It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(256704841) by changing a digit.

It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(19) of ones.

It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 128352170 + 128352171.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(128352171).
